Understanding Inpatient Drug Rehabilitation in Mount Pleasant Mills, Pennsylvania

If you have been dealing with substance abuse, you might have to search for the right inp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ation center to address your condition. These facilities typically offer intensive services with a number of tools and therapy to empower their patients to conquer their dependence on addictive, mind-altering, and intoxicating substances. Participating in such a Mount Pleasant Mills program, therefore, could make it possible for you to get on the path to full recovery and succeed in leading a happy, productive, and successful life.

Additionally, inpatient alcohol and drug treatment will allow you to live with others dealing with the same or similar drug and alcohol addictions. During this time, you will benefit from the help, support, and care you require to overcome your condition in a comfortable location free of alcohol and drugs.

24/7 care

In the same way, residential drug centers - as inpatient treatment is also called - will offer you with around the clock support. Most of these facilities have highly qualified and certified drug addiction rehab professionals that can monitor you as you continue living in the facility for a given period.

If the facility is inside a hospital, the health professionals on staff can also provide around the clock medical care and monitoring. On the other hand, if it is outside a hospital setting, you may benefit from intermittent support from on-call medical staff.

12 Step and Non 12 Step Recovery Groups

Most inp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ation programs in Mount Pleasant Mills, PA. will mandate that you undergo therapy every day. In some cases, you might also be asked to attend and participate in 12 step support group meetings. Through these meetings, you will receive recovery advice, encouragement, and support from other peers also battling similar drug addictions. You will even get the chance to work through specific, fail proof actions that others have taken to find total recovery.

Last but not least, the facility may also have alternative non-12 step recovery sessions that follow similar models of rehab but with a focus that is not as religious or faith-based.
